A special women's world day of prayer service suitable for men, women and children is being held in St Remigius Church, Hethersett, at 2pm on Friday when the preacher will be the Rev Mary Kerslake.

The church will be decorated with Easter lilies this year from March 22with members of the public able to buy flowers in memory of loved ones.

There will be a Norfolk twist to a special Easter event in the church on Palm Sunday (March 16) when the evening service at 6.30pm will give an account of the Passion in Norfolk dialect read by Catherine and Sarah Mapes who are members of the Friends of Norfolk Dialect Society. The special text is written by a Methodist minister, The Rev Colin Riches.
